τόρν-ευμα · torn-euma — LSJ
whirling motion, as of a lathe; cf. τόρευμα II.
pl., turnerʼs chips or shavings. Hp. Ulc. 12, IG ΙΙ(2).287A 23 (Delos, iii B. C.), Dsc. 1.80, Ruf. Ren.Ves. 8.5.
